In an ideal gas, there are no intermolecular attractions, and the volume of the gas particles is negligible. The Ideal Gas Law is a convenient approximation of most gas phase reactions, but does not always sufficiently describe real gases near the condensation point, near the critical point, or at high pressures. Online chemistry calculators, Periodic Table of the Elements, Ideal Gas deviations from the ideal behavior. answers to the correct number of significant figures. 5 The Ideal Gas Law and Reaction Stoichiometry Section 5. 7 Real Gases: Deviations from Ideal Behavior 7. ) Explain why large gaseous molecules deviate from ideal behavior. and high pressure At High T, the gas molecules have a higher average kinetic energy (KEavg) which overcomes the Intermolecular attractive forces. At Low P, the gas molecules are spread further apart and can therefore avoid Intermolecular attractive forces. The ideal gas law assumes that the gas molecules have no volume. Since real gases have volumes, real volume is greater than ideal. It also assumes that there are no intermolecular forces between the gas molecules.
